Space Knight is the alias King Endymion adopts in the Kaguya Island storyline of the Sailor Moon stage musicals. Traveling back from the future, he uses the disguise to shield his runaway daughter Chibiusa and the younger versions of his wife and their allies while they are cut off from their powers.
No detailed look for the Space Knight is on record; the identity functions above all as a cover that keeps King Endymion's true face hidden. Only once the final confrontation is underway does he shed the guise and reveal who he really is.
Everything the Space Knight does is rooted in a father's protectiveness. He trails Chibiusa across time to keep her safe and stands guard over the past incarnations of Neo-Queen Serenity and her companions during the stretch when they cannot call on their transformations.

When Chibiusa fled her home and settled in with Usagi and Mamoru in the twentieth century, King Endymion pursued her to Kaguya Island under the Space Knight name. In that role he defended his daughter and her vulnerable allies, and after he came to Loof Merrow's aid against the servants of Coatl, she developed feelings for him and later repaid the debt by rescuing him in turn. During the climactic struggle with Dark Plasman he finally disclosed his identity, then made his way back to the thirtieth century together with Chibiusa. The part was played by Yuuta Mochizuki.

The role of the Space Knight was played by Yuuta Mochizuki in Pretty Soldier Sailor Moon: The Legend of Kaguya Island. It marks the character's first appearance in the Sera Myu stage productions.
